Output 644426a69cd91bccb4ff8c6b18708164f671dfba2c9d20a99560ecd542aac53e:0

value
66108988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 327a95aa7cd7d9039a447247352effcb354204fe OP_EQUALVERIFY OP_CHECKSIG
address
15budvReKz9Zvfo772wBJnizEVZHzK2j3k
transaction
644426a69cd91bccb4ff8c6b18708164f671dfba2c9d20a99560ecd542aac53e
spent
true